Spam updates are automated, low-quality content refreshes designed to manipulate search rankings by injecting irrelevant keywords or links. They’re used by black-hat SEO practitioners to artificially boost visibility, often harming user experience. Legitimate sites avoid this tactic, as search engines penalize it. Only unethical marketers benefit short-term, while users and honest businesses suffer from degraded search results and trust.
